435. Deputy Louise O'Reilly asked the Minister for Health the process which was undertaken before the downgrading of Ennis and Nenagh hospitals to ensure that University Hospital Limerick would have the necessary capacity to cope with the centralisation of emergency care in the region. [21888/19]
